Cnoc a'Chonasg, Lyndale is a beautiful light and spacious holiday cottage. It has expansive views on three sides; looking out over the back of the Trotternish Ridge, to the Cuillin mountains and to the hills of Harris on the Western Isles. You can in theory watch the aurora borealis from the sofa, but it’s better to go outside!
